Integrating the Calculus-Based Method into OCL: Study of Expressiveness and Code Generation

This paper aims at describing the integration of the calculus-based method (CBM) into the object constraint language (OCL) in order to facilitate the specification of topological constraints in spatial databases. A first study related to the expressiveness is presented, as well as a specific architecture for database trigger generation from OCL specification